- 1、本文档共48页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
12章MATLAB在电路中应用课件
第12章 利用MATLAB计算电路;12.1 MATLAB的概述 ; MATLAB的主要结构和功能;12.2 MATLAB程序设计基础; MATLAB 7.5桌面集成环境;(2)命令窗口;命令窗口环境;(3)工作空间管理窗口;(4)命令历史窗口;(5)当前目录窗口 ;(6)Start菜单 ;(7)编译窗口(MATLAB文本编辑窗口);启动MATLAB文本编辑器的3种方法;利用命令窗口和M文件进行编程。;2.程序控制结构;利用输入函数进行数据的输入。;2.程序控制结构;2.程序控制结构;2.程序控制结构;2.程序控制结构;利用多分支if语句进行编程。;3)switch语句 ;利用switch语句进行数据的选择。;2.程序控制结构;2.程序控制结构;2.程序控制结构;2.程序控制结构;2.程序控制结构;12.3 电路的传递函数及频率特性;频域响应曲线;12.4 MATLAB 在基本电路中的应用例举; 解:这是涉及简单直流电路-戴维南定理的应用电路分析与计算。该电路不含受控源,仅含独立直流电流源。戴维南定理直接应用于简单直流电路的简单电路,可以使用网孔法、节点电压法等方法解决。在这里介绍使用节点电压法解此题。;先求ao端以左的戴维南等效电路。
首先用一个电流为ia的独立直流电流源代替电阻RL,以o点作为参考点,设其电位为零,其次设各个节点电压分别为u1,u2,ua,如图12-13所示;最后根据图12-13可以写出该电路的节点方程组如下所示:;将其写成矩阵形式如式12-4所示 ;编程思想为:令ia=0,is=2A,is2=0.5A,由式(12-4)解得u11,u21,ua1。因为ia=0,由(12-5)可得:uoc=ua1。再令is1=is2=0,ia=1A,仍由式(12-4)解得另一组u21,u22,ua2。由于内部独立电源is1=is2=0,故uoc=0。 ;根据对题目的理论分析,编写MATLAB程序代码如下:
clear,format compact
R1=4;R2=2;R3=4;R4=8; %设置元件参数
is1=2;is2=0.5; %按A*X=B*is列出此电路的矩阵方程。其中X=[u1;u2;ua],is=[is1;is2;ia]
a11=1/R1+1/R4;a12=-1/R1;a13=-1/R4; %设置系数矩阵A
a21=-1/R1;a22=1/R1+1/R2+1/R3;a23=-1/R3;
a31=-1/R4;a32=-1/R3;a33=1/R3+1/R4;
A=[a11,a12,a13;a21,a22,a23;a31,a32,a33];B=[1,1,0;0,0,0;0,-1,1]; %设置系数矩阵B;%方法一:令ia=0,求Uoc=X1(3);再令is1=is2=0,设ia=1,求Req=ua/ia=X2(3)
X1=A\B*[is1;is2;0];Uoc=X1(3)
X2=A\B*[0;0;1];Req=X2(3)
RL=Req;P=Uoc^2*RL/(Req+RL)^2 %求其最大功率
RL=0:0.01:10;P=(RL*Uoc./(Req+RL)).*Uoc./(Req+RL); %设RL序列求其功率
figure(1),plot(RL,P), grid %画出功耗随RL变化的曲线
计算结果为:
Uoc =
5.0000
Req =
5.0000
P =
1.2500;功率随负载的变化曲线如下图所示 ;2.正弦稳态电路分析 ; 解:采用网孔电流法求解,设如图12-13所示3个网孔电流分别为,下面列写网孔的回路方程:;% 输入初始参数R1=2;R2=2;R3=2;R4=2;C1=5e-4;C2=8e-4;L1=1e-3;L2=2e-3;w=1000;US=10;ZR1=R1;ZR2=R2;ZR3=R3;ZR4=R4;ZC1=1\(j*w*C1) ;ZC2=1\(j*w*C2);ZL1=j*w*L1;ZL2=j*w*L2;
% 计算方程组系数矩阵中各元素的值
Z11=ZR1+ZR4+ZC2+ZL1;Z12=-ZR4;Z21=-ZR4;Z13=-ZC2;Z31=-ZC2;Z22=ZR2+ZR4+ZC1;
Z23=-ZR2;Z33=ZR2+ZR3+ZC2+ZL2;Z32=-ZR2;;% 组成方程组、求解结点电流
A=[Z11 Z12 Z13;Z21 Z22 Z23;Z31 Z32 Z33];
B=[0;US;0];
I=A\B。
程序运行结果为:
I1=1.4451-1.3276i
I2=3.5402-1.7874i
I3=1.0821-1.3621i;3.暂态电路分析 ;解:首先设电容电压u为未知量,根据换路定理得出:u(0+)=u(0-)=9v,再根据回路方程和电容
文档评论(0)